Primary Teachers - Portsmouth - September

Portsmouth - Daily, Short and Long Term - September starting

Are you a Qualified, local teacher seeking regular supply work across Portsmouth & Hampshire?

Over the last few years we have had some of our busiest periods when it comes to supply, and we expect the same level of need for the rest of the Academic year and into the next!

Academics Hampshire are recruiting strong, confident Primary Teachers for daily cover.

We are seeking Primary Teachers, across key stage 1 and 2, to work with our network of local schools all across Portsmouth - regular local short term work and long term opportunities available.

You may be an ECT looking to gain more experience before settling into a permanent role, or perhaps you're an established teacher looking for some flexibility in your work - we can offer a good amount of supply, work in varied schools in the area and even find you a long term or permanent contract during your time with us.

As a supply teacher, you will have:

* Experience of working in UK schools across KS1 - KS2
* Excellent knowledge of the UK National Curriculum
* Flexible, adaptable and reliable attitude
* Strong behaviour management skills and the ability to inspire pupils
* Right to work in the UK
* UK QTS/QTLS status
* An enhanced DBS certificate registered to the Update Service (or be willing to apply for a new one - we can help with this process)
